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,054 per month in Korce vs $1,388 in Tirana,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,559 per month in Korce vs $2,245 in Tirana,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,063 per month in Korce vs $3,102 in Tirana, rent included.

Korce is about 24% cheaper than Tirana,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Korce sits 23% below the global median, while Tirana is 1%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$484 in Korce versus $854 in Tirana.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 32% higher in Tirana,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$40.00 in Korce versus $54.0 in Tirana.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$252 vs $298 – making Korce the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
